you increase your walking speed from 1 m/s to 3 m/s in a period of 1 s. What is your acceleration? A) 2 m/s ^2 B) 3 m/s ^2 C) 5

m/s ^2 D) 4 m/s ^2
Mathematics
2 answers:
arsen [322]3 years ago
8 0
Acceleration is to change in speed divided by the time for the change. Change in speed is end speed minus started speed.  

3m/s-1m/s and equals to 2m/s.

The answer should be A. (2m/s^2.)

A ​used-boat dealership buys a boat for ​$2800 and then sells it for ​$4000. What is the percent​ increase?
Rudik [331]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

percent increase = increase divided by original number x 100

                           

increase is the difference between the two numbers...

new number - original number.....4000 - 2800 = 1200

percent increase = (1200 / 2800) x 100

                            = 0.42857 (round to .4286) x 100

                             = 42.86 %.....if you need it rounded to the nearest percent, it      would be 43% increase
